Mrs. Sara Campbell Hillman, age 87 of Cedartown, Georgia, passed away on Tuesday, June 7, 2011. She was born on March 17, 1924 in Polk County; she was the daughter of the late Mr. and Mrs. John Rubin and Sara Williams Campbell.
Mrs. Hillman worked as a school administrator for many years in Warren, Michigan for a private church school.
Mrs. Hillman is survived by her loving husband of 65 years Mr. Wiley C. Hillman; sister, Martha McCurry and several nieces and nephews also survive.
Mrs. Hillman is preceded in death by her parents and several brothers and sisters.
